This single stroller with a standing platform is perfect for parents who want a stroller to accommodate two kids and one of them is younger. It's more expensive than the top tandem stroller, but it's constructed better and comes with a better resale price.

The traditional stroller seat can be folded down to accommodate an infant car seat. Big children can leap on the rear padded seat. The riding board can be stowed and removed with just a click and is able to remain in place when not being used.

Easy to Fold

When selecting a stroller for travel, you want to make sure it folds down into a size that is easy to store. It should also be light so you can carry it around. The Contours Itsy fits the bill. It's a sleek, lightweight option that looks great and folds easily. It's also fully assembled from the box, so you don't need to do a lot of work in order to prepare it for transport. It's a no-frills stroller, which means you do not have to worry about a hefty basket or a lot of cups that take up space. It's not just a simple stroller. It has smooth riding that is easy to maneuver.

The stroller can be used from birth and with infant car seats by buying an adapter. It offers a full recline for the back seat and can be used with a sitting toddler to allow an escorted ride with a sibling or set up as a two-seater by placing the infant seat in the back and an additional stand-on board in front (which requires some maneuvering as the front seat doesn't recline). The UPF 50+ canopy of the stroller is huge and provides plenty of shade. When not being used the platform that stands on its own can be folded into the storage basket.

The Trvl folds down into an ultra-compact package and the footrest is able to be adjusted to make more space. It's one of the fastest travel strollers we've ever tested to fold, and it takes less than 10 seconds to fold using both hands. It's also extremely light for a travel stroller with a weight of just 17 pounds. However, it's not as small as some of the other strollers we tried and might not fit in some airlines' overhead bins. It's also not as easy to recline or incline as other models we test. The buckle has five pieces, which can make it difficult for little kids to clip. It's a great choice for families moving and require an easy-to-use stroller for any terrain.

Easy to Assemble

Whether you're just starting out with a single stroller or planning to add a second seat, you must choose one that's easy to set up. Look for a model that's easy to push the wheels and bumper bar in place. You will save yourself the hassle of having to quickly take the stroller out for a walk. Also, check if the handles adjust to accommodate different heights.

A good single running stroller stroller with a standing board is one that can grow with your family. A majority of the models we've reviewed can be converted into double strollers using car seat adapters and bassinets. They can also accommodate additional toddler seats in the back. This makes them ideal for siblings with varying ages.

The Chicco BravoFor2 is a good example. It can hold up two infant car seats from the majority of major brands. This allows you to start your child off in the car and then change to a standing one when they are older. It is also compatible with a child's rider board.

Another option worth considering is the UPPAbaby Vista. It's more expensive than some of our other top picks however, it's well worth the price if you are looking for a quality stroller that will last for years to be. It is compatible with multiple car seat models such as Nuna and Maxi Cosi, and has a large storage basket under the stroller, which can be used to store diaper bags, shopping bag and other items.

Another feature we love about this model is its sleek, simple design. This stroller is perfect for families who want an ultra-compact stroller. It's also easy to store and carry. It is light enough to lift out of and into your car's trunk, and it folds flat in just a click. The rain cover included is a nice addition and it's also. It's simple to figure out how to attach, and it comes in handy when you want to shield your child from sudden downpours on the go. It's available in various color options, too, so you can find the style that suits your family best.
